DR Mammography에서 평균유선선량 감소를 위한 방안

The Study for Average Glandular Dose Reduction in Digital Mammography

Purpose : In digital mammography, Exposure condition was automatically chosen using by measurement breast thickness and the density of mammary gland. It may cause a lack of recognition about an appropriate exposure condition and total exposure dose which would be high through the more increase dose and the image quality was better. For search a minimum dose at diagnosis and find a minimum scan parameter, in our study using an authorization standard breast phantom from ACR(American collage of radiology). Materials and methods : AOP mode of Digital mammography(Senographe DS) used with Standard, Contrast, Dose mode take every 3 times and archived 9 images for reproducibility in same parameters. In Manual mode, kVp was fixed 29 and mAs was changed from 40 to 4 in 11steps, it take every 3 times and archived 33 images for reproducibility in same parameters. Phantom image was evaluated and analze by SPSS program with mAs, phantom scoring, evaluation of false region, image quality, SNR and average glandular dose. Results : Average glandular dose is revealed the highest dose in contrast mode, the lowest dose in dose mode out of AOP mode. The scoring of false region was passed on ACR quality control standard, it was above 0.58mGy at average glandular dose(59% of standard mode) and 25mAs(61% of standard mode). It has a right statistical correlation. Do evaluations of false region with the naked eye, the order of correlation with average glandular dose was such as following speck, fiber, mass. It has a right statistical correlation. Also evaluation of image quality was above score 3(good) which more than 0.92mGy(93% of standard mode) and 40mAs(98% of standard mode). It has a right statistical correlation. SNR was satisfied with standard score, more than 0.58mGy average glandular dose(63% of standard mode), and 25mAs(61% of standard mode). It has a right statistical correlation, too. Conclusion : The image quality of possibly diagnosis could maintain by low average glandular dose and mAs by Manual mode which less than AOP mode parameters of the existing digital mammography. Also it could reduce average glandular dose. Also it could change minimum parameters accompany with a shape of lesion. This method is innovative plan of reduction of patient dose about unnecessary radiation exposure by using a AOP mode but Manual mode with previous reference parameters when follow-up study and post operation patient exam.
